Johnny Hates Jazz

Johnny Hates Jazz is an English pop/rock band, formed in London in 1986 by Clark Datchler (vocals, keyboards, guitar), Mike Nocito (bass, guitar), and Calvin Hayes (keyboards, drums). In April 1987 they saw international success with their first hit single "Shattered Dreams".
